If you’re not already completely absorbed in this morning’s inauguration activities, jump over to SpeechWars and check out their graphs of different words our nation’s Presidents have spoken in their Inaugural addresses – from women to union to world to evildoers (oh, wait, that’s not one) and notice any trends that may have occurred due to such powerful cultural changes caused by the civil rights movement and the rise of feminism. What Obama will say, we don’t know – strangely, unlike CNN we didn’t receive a copy of it – but we have a hunch the word “hope” will pop up more times than it did in the last eight years.
